Among the list of attribute Attributes of nociceptors is their ability to cause sensitization, which is the potential to boost neuronal excitability. Sensitization can be a process that consists of a reduction in the edge of activation, and also an increase in the reaction fee to destructive stimulation. It always results from tissue insult and inflammation [22]. Also, stimuli that do not create an result ahead of the entire process of sensitization usually takes spot may perhaps subsequently come to be efficient and build spontaneous activity soon after sensitization occurs [23].

Nociceptor sensitivity is modulated by a considerable selection of mediators in the extracellular Area, for example poisonous and inflammatory molecules.[16][four] Peripheral sensitization represents a sort of functional plasticity with the what are pain receptors nociceptor. The nociceptor can transform from getting simply a noxious stimulus detector into a detector of non-noxious stimuli. The end result is small intensity stimuli from standard action, initiates a painful feeling. This is usually called hyperalgesia. Inflammation is a person common result in that brings about the sensitization of nociceptors.
